What's The Definition Of Waldheimia?Synonyms | Synonyms for Waldheimia: Related Terms | Find terms related to Waldheimia: See Also | Waldheimia In Webster's Dictionary \Wald*hei"mi*a\, n. [NL.] (Zo["o]l.)
A genus of brachiopods of which many species are found in the
fossil state. A few still exist in the deep sea.
